ASI to restore Kedarnath on lines of Shore temple


LUCKNOW
The strategy used by the Archaeological Survey of India team to restore Shore temple in Mahabalipuram would provide the line of action for restoration of Kedarnath temple.

“The problem in Kedarnath resembles the challenge that came our way while restoring the Shore Temple of Mahabalipuram. While in the south, it was the Bay of Bengal that did the damage, in Kedarnath, the fast moving Mandakini river that gushes into the temple from the rear end ravaged the shrine. We will have to find a solution to the phenomenon of water flowing in from behind,” said Dr BR Mani, head of the ASI team which reached Uttrakhand to inspect the affected site on Sunday.
